**Assessing Specialist**

Ready to kickstart your career? You will be responsible for supporting our National Home Claims Assessing team to deliver a Best in Class Claims experience for our internal claims team, business partners and customers. This role will suit a team member with Trade, Assessing and Leader experience where you have provided coaching, technical support, facilitation and have a strong background in Claims. You will be a team player who can work autonomously and plan their workloads with mínimal direction, as well as working in a team environment supporting your peers where required to achieve team goals.

**Here's what you'll do**:

- Contribute to continuous development and uplift of capabilities across Assessing and Supply Chain
- Deliver professional and brilliant service when interacting with internal and external Assessors, Building Coordinators, Supply Chain, and other stakeholders in line with Suncorp's excellence standards and principles
- Provide relevant technical advice that balances customer needs with business outcomes
- Develop plans and materials to deliver tailored workshops, coaching and training programs that drive consistency, best in class and a brilliant customer experience
- Provide technical and operational business support where required on projects as an Assessing SME, including feedback on proposed technical changes, PDS changes and process change
- Support Onboarding and facilitating induction training, including high support for new recruits
- Regularly review and communicate business practices ensuring national consistency, governance and process standards are met
- Proactive risk management and compliance with industry standards

**Here's what you'll bring**:

- Claims insurance experience and/or Claims Assessing experience
- Experience within the Building trade (desired)
- Strong ability to interpret policies and to determine the correct policy response
- Capability to use different technology/systems
- Highly developed organisational and time management skills
- Proven performer in customer service roles
- Skilled in analysis, problem solving, decision making and negotiation skills
- Strong coaching and mentoring skills
- Established stakeholder and relationship management
